Steam Fear and Hunger: What’s Driving the Growing Concern in the US

In recent months, discussions about Steam Fear and Hunger have surged online, reflecting a deeper wave of awareness around gaming-related stress, financial pressure, and digital burnout. What started as quiet conversations in gaming communities is now shaping a broader cultural conversation—especially among players seeking balance in an increasingly demanding and commercialized digital landscape. This trend is not about addiction or obsession, but about real psychological and economic realities tied to modern gaming culture. As more users navigate endless content, subscription costs, and social pressure to “keep up,” the quiet struggles around Steam Fear and Hunger are emerging as key points of awareness.

Why is this topic growing now? Economic uncertainty, rising subscription fees for major gaming platforms, and the relentless pace of content creation have shifted player expectations. Many are feeling stretched thin—not just by time, but by financial investment. The digital economy’s shift toward “always-on” engagement has created environments where exhaustion and anxiety can quietly deepen. Steam Fear—defined as growing unease about over-commitment to games, microtransactions, or time spent in persistent online worlds—reflects a natural caution. Meanwhile, Hunger denotes the psychological strain tied to performance pressure, fear of missing out, or social expectations to maintain active participation. These dynamics are particularly palpable in the U.S., where gaming is both a cultural cornerstone and an economic marketplace.
